Fiberglass Fabric Market in Japan Trends and Forecast
The future of the fiberglass fabric market in Japan looks promising with opportunities in the wind energy, transportation, electrical & electronic, construction, marine, and aerospace & defense markets. The global fiberglass fabric market is expected to grow with a CAGR of 6.1% from 2026 to 2035. The fiberglass fabric market in Japan is also forecasted to witness strong growth over the forecast period. The major drivers for this market are the increasing demand for lightweight materials, the rising adoption in the automotive industry, and the growing need for fire-resistant fabrics.
• Lucintel forecasts that, within the type category, e-glass will remain a larger segment over the forecast period.
• Within the application category, wind energy is expected to witness the highest growth.

The challenges in the fiberglass fabric market in Japan are:
• Fluctuating Raw Material Prices: The cost of raw materials such as silica and resin significantly impacts production expenses. Price volatility due to supply chain disruptions or global market fluctuations can reduce profit margins and hinder consistent supply, affecting overall market stability.
• Stringent Regulatory Environment: Japan enforces strict safety, environmental, and quality standards. Compliance requires continuous investment in R&D and process modifications, increasing operational costs and potentially delaying product launches, which can limit market agility.
• Competition from Alternative Materials: The rise of advanced composites, carbon fibers, and other lightweight materials presents a challenge to fiberglass fabric‘s market share. These alternatives often offer superior strength-to-weight ratios or environmental benefits, compelling manufacturers to innovate and differentiate their products.
